WebApr 28, 2024 · Jelly is a clear product firm enough to hold its shape when turned out of the jar, but quivers when moved. Jam is a thick, sweet spread made with crushed or chopped fruits. The pieces of fruit are very small. Jams tend to … WebJul 16, 2012 · Jelly: Just the juice, nothing but the juice. And sugar. No seeds, whole berries or chunks of fruit. Clear and well-jelled. Jam: Crushed, puréed or chopped fruit cooked down with sugar. A soft, chunk-free pulp. Preserve: Chopped or whole fruit cooked with sugar until a syrupy base able to suspend the fruit chunks develops.
